How do you deflate the crew life vest?

Explanation:
Deflating an inflatable crew life vest is done by venting the air from the bladder through the purge valves on the manual inflation tubes. Pressing these purge valves allows air to escape quickly and safely, reducing buoyancy so the vest can be collapsed or re-packed as needed. The other actions either inflate the vest or have no effect on deflation (pulling a red tab inflates, blowing into the tube would add air, and twisting the inflation handle isn’t used for deflation). Use the purge valves to control and finish deflation.
